June and July is the primary school enrollment season. With the increase of new schools and the expansion of schools, more and more children from migrant workers can attend. In July 10th, the reporter learned that Liu Ying Ting, the hero of the 6 year old girl who had a dream of going to school in December 2014, had been studying in the new elementary school for two years.
in December 2014, reporters met Liu Yiting, 6, when he swept the street. She came from Surabaya County in Jining and divorced from her parents. She had a three grade sister, Liu Yiling, who lived in Ji'nan with her grandparents and lived in a sanitation worker's dormitory on the west side of building 19, North Gate North Road. The room was less than ten square meters.
